28 Years of Animation Based in California, Pixar is an American animation studio best known for their creation of CGI-animated films. Each film they have produced has been a critical and financial hit, all fourteen of them equally charming and innovative. The studio has won a total of twenty-seven Academy Awards, eleven Grammy awards, and seven Global Globe Awards. So far, the company has made over $8.5 billion worldwide.

History of Pixar Pixar studios began in 1979 as a subdivision of Lucasfilms, before being bought by Steve Jobs and established as an independent studio. In 2006 it became a part of The Walt Disney Studios. In 1989 Pixar released Photorealistic RenderMan, a revolutionary computer program which has not only been used on Pixar’s cg movies, but also blockbuster hits such as Titanic, the Star Wars prequels, and The Lord of the Rings. After poor sales of Pixar’s computers in the late eighties and early nineties, the animation department began producing computer animated commercials for outside companies. In 1991, after a difficult beginning to the year, letting almost half of their employees go, Pixar made a $26 million deal with Disney to produce 3 cg animated feature films, the first of which was Toy Story. After the movie’s success, Pixar continued it’s to rise to fame, alongside Disney. They recently celebrated their 25th anniversary with the release of Pixar’s twelfth feature film, Cars 2.

Pixar’s style Pixar’s style is very simple, their characters are made of basic shapes and are extremely caricatured. From the rectangle that is Carl (from Up) to the triangular torso of Mr. Incredible (from The Incredibles) simple shapes are the obvious building blocks of Pixar’s style. Miyazaki’s Totoro in Pixar’s Toy Story 3: Miyazaki and Pixar Unsurprisingly, the fluid anime of Studio Ghibli and Hayao Miyazaki has, and will undoubtedly continue to play a large influence on the animation industry. Pete Docter, director of the films Up and Monsters, Inc. as well as a co-creator of other Pixar works, has described anime, specifically Miyazaki, as an influence on his work. Toy Story Toy Story was Pixar’s first full length film, about the toys in a boy’s room. It was the first movie to feature total CGI. While movies like Lion King and Beauty and the Beast featured CGI, there had never been a full CGI movie. When the film was released, John Lasseter, who directed the film, was given an Academy Award, creating the Best Animated Feature film category, and inspired many other animated hit films such as Shrek, Ice Age and Kung Fu Panda.

The Incredibles This quirky story about a family of superheroes was Pixar’s 6th film. It required new technology to animate detailed human anatomy, clothing,realistic skin, and hair. Before this film, the amount of hair and cloth had never been done before! It was said to be their most complicated film (CGI-wise) to make. They had to spend a whole year working out the rigs before actually starting the animation process. This film paved the way for their future character animation, giving Pixar new tools to make more realistic human characters.

UP Up is a 2009 movie about a house that lifts into the clouds by thousands of attached balloons. The protagonists are an unusual trio consisting of a bitter old man, an excitable wild scout, and a dog that can talk due to his collar. Pixar truly showed their artistic style in this film, especially in terms of the visuals and story. The tale is unusually tender and bittersweet, yet is able to remain humorous. Most importantly, the character’s have an exaggerated look-- but pixar manages to make it look appealing and the movements realistic.

Their storytelling shined in the unforgettable montage of Carl and Ellie’s love story.
